Company Overview

Company history and background logo History and Background

FuelCell Energy, Inc. was founded in 1969. It develops, manufactures, installs, and operates fuel cell technology platforms for power generation.

Company business area logo Core Business Areas

  • Service Agreements: Long-term service agreements to maintain and service its fuel cell platforms, contributing to recurring revenue.
  • Power Generation: Generates and sells electricity directly to utilities and commercial customers using its installed fuel cell plants.
  • Advanced Technologies: Develops advanced technologies such as carbon capture and hydrogen production using fuel cell technology.
  • Fuel Cell Manufacturing: Manufacturing and sales of fuel cell stacks and systems.

leadership logo Leadership and Structure

Jason Few is the President and CEO. The company has a board of directors and operates with a functional organizational structure across departments like engineering, sales, and finance.

Top Products and Market Share

Product Key Offerings logo Key Offerings

  • SureSource Power Plants: Fuel cell power plants that generate clean electricity and heat. FuelCell Energy has a limited market share in the overall distributed generation market. Competitors include Bloom Energy, Cummins, and General Electric.
  • SureSource Capture: Carbon capture systems integrated with fuel cells. The market is emerging, with limited market share data currently available. Competitors include Mitsubishi Heavy Industries, and Saipem.
  • SureSource Hydrogen: Hydrogen production via fuel cell technology. The market is rapidly expanding, and market share data is still developing. Competitors include Plug Power, and ITM Power.

Competitive Landscape

FuelCell Energy competes with companies specializing in fuel cells (Bloom Energy and Ballard Power) and also broader energy companies. FuelCell Energy is differentiating by focusing on large-scale industrial application. However, the company's financial health is less robust than the financial health of its competitors.

FuelCell Energy,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, manufactures and sells stationary fuel cell and electrolysis platforms that decarbonize power and produce hydrogen. The company provides various configurations and applications of its platform, including on-site power, utility grid support, and microgrid, as well as distributed hydrogen; solid oxide-based electrolysis; solutions for long duration hydrogen-based energy storage and electrolysis technology; and carbon capture, separation, and utilization systems. It also offers technology to produce electricity, heat, clean hydrogen, and water. In addition, the company provides turn-key solutions, including development, engineering, procurement, construction, interconnection, and operation services. It serves various markets, including utilities and independent power producers, data centers and communication, wastewater treatment, government, commercial and hospitality, food and beverage, microgrids, manufacturing, pharmaceutical processing, universities, healthcare facilities, industrial hydrogen, port, oil and gas, wind and solar projects, and hydrogen for mobility and material handling, as well as engineering, procurement, and construction firms. The company primarily operates in the United States, South Korea, Europe, and Canada. FuelCell Energy, Inc. was founded in 1969 and is headquartered in Danbury, Connecticut.
